
Harris Semiconductor
Description
CD4541B programmable timer consists of a 16-stage binary counter, an oscillator that is controlled by external R-C components (2 resistors and a capacitor), an automatic power-on reset circuit, and output control logic. The counter increments on positive-edge clock transitions and can also be reset via the MASTER RESET input.
FEATUREs
• Low Symmetrical Output Resistance, Typically 100Ω at VDD = 15V
• Built-In Low-Power RC Oscillator
• Oscillator Frequency Range . . . . . . . . . . DC to 100kHz
• External Clock (Applied to Pin 3) can be Used Instead of Oscillator
• Operates as 2N Frequency Divider or as a Single Transition Timer
• Q/Q Select Provides Output Logic Level Flexibility
• AUTO or MASTER RESET Disables Oscillator During Reset to Reduce Power Dissipation
• Operates With Very Slow Clock Rise and Fall Times
• Capable of Driving Six Low Power TTL Loads, Three Low-Power Schottky Loads, or Six HTL Loads Over the Rated Temperature Range
• Symmetrical Output Characteristics
• 100% Tested for Quiescent Current at 20V
• 5V, 10V, and 15V Parametric Ratings
• Meets All Requirements of JEDEC Standard No. 13B, “Standard Specifications for Description of ‘B’ Series CMOS Devices”
